It has come to my attention that this conference, so far has only been concerned with territory. This is a silly and vain thing. This conference's goals are not only about territory but about securing peace between Micras's two greatest powers. This conference began about territory but must be expanded past that to greater and more noble things. The peace of micras depends on our nation's cooperation. For the Shirithians to give us territory and do no more and the Anticans to take the territory and ask for no more would be a grave mistake. Initiatives must be taken to secure that our two nations can return to warmer relations. Is it the responsibility of this meeting to secure that warmer relations return. This goal should supercede all territorial talks.

Today's situation is a sad one, there is so much hard feelings between Antica and Shireroth. Now, the source of this tension is gone, and most of us believe, and hope, in both the Shirekeep in Nafticon, that he is gone for good. I believe all can toast to the positive effects of his leaving us. With this source of tension gone, wew must try to mend the links which he severed in his neverending megalomaniacal quests. How are we to go about this? I have ideas, but I don't have all the ideas. I will propose a few thoughts I have had over the past couple of days.

1. Economic bonds in the past have proven to be a great stimulator of peace. One only needs to look at the tongue and cheek "Golden Arches theory of Conflict Prevention" (that no two nations with a macdonalds will go to war). Antica, is at the moment attempting to start up an economy whihc combines simulationism with real economics. I believe it is high time we set up an Antican common market between our two nations. The more we interact with eachother, the less likely we are to hate eachother.

2. SNARL. We need a SNARL war. It almost happened but then the trial cut that line off. We should restart that proposed war as soon as possible. It can only serve to draw us closer together.

3. There are many Shirithians who double over as Anticans but not many Anticans who jump over to Shireroth for a dual citizenship. Maybe we could encourage a portion of the population to become dual citizens. We need less of me and more of Baldwin.

4. A board of grievances. This is sort of what they do in countries like South Africa. We need to be able to have some resolution to our personal grudges with eachother. International psychotherapy.

These are only a couple of my ideas. I think this is far more important than territory.

First of all, I agree. Territory was only the initiator of these talks, not simply the actual point. It was meant to reconcile our grudges so that we could become allies again, just like we were allies in the old Dinarchy days.


1. I'm not sure if that is a good idea. First of all, Shireroth doesn't even have a real economy, although de jure we have a post-based economy. Second of all, plenty of people here have their doubts on the feasibility of any economic system. The reason why our Ministry of Trade has been inactive has been because we havn't found a system that works for us. So if we did this, it would probably bomb.

2. Technically wasn't it more of my fault than the trial's? :p I agree, although I'm not sure if I can particpate myself. The problem is getting people who are interested.

3. Completely agree. Perhaps we could relaxen the restrictions on dual citizenship for our nations for the sole exception of our pair opf nations.

4. Ha! You'd have to have a whole board for myself before a Shirerothian-Antican one. :p Good idea, though.

I provisionally agree with Bill about economics. Right now I don't understand your economic system and I haven't been able to find enough publically accessible information about it to learn more. Once we learn more about it we might be more supportive of it.

I think part of the problem you mention in 3 has to do with Shirerithians not being able to access most of Antica's forums. I used to go hang out at Antica all the time; now I don't because I know I can't participate in any of the interesting discussions.

If you were to have a visa program where people who you know are responsible and not going to cause trouble could apply to access and post on whichever of your boards don't contain important national secrets, we could try to reciprocate in some way. We don't really have any secret boards other than ones relating to military and intelligence that have to stay secret, but we could invite you guys to our chats or something.

Also, Kaiser, since you live right next to a lot of Anticans (Gemini and a couple of others are Long Islanders), you might try meeting them in person. That's usually a pretty good tension-reliever.

As for number four, I don't think Shireroth really has any outstanding grievances with you other than you occasionally insulting or yelling at us. It's more of an atmosphere of distrust than any particular easily solveable issue, and I feel like that can only be resolved by waiting until a period of better relations pushes that distrust out of our minds.

The Treaty of Alcyon

Preamble

THE IMPERIAL REPUBLIC OF SHIREROTH and THE REPUBLIC OF ANTICA, having found their interests to be congruent, and desirous of peace and prosperity for and between both nations, hereby agree to form a treaty of friendship and support, the Treaty of Alcyon, in order to guide the reestablishment of positive relations between the two nations.

ARTICLE 1: Land

A.) The Imperial Republic of Shireroth cedes the counties of Skiron, Mesoun, and Platea to the Republic of Antica.
B.) The County of Kaikias is to be according to the diagram below. All lands north and west of the border (drawn in black) are to be Antican, including the former Capital of Kaikias, Neronea. The capital of Shirithian Kaikias is to be moved north, to the city of Civitas Atia, whose name is to be changed by it's count outside the scope of this treaty.

ARTICLE 2: Reconciliation

A.) A Board of Grievances shall be formed to handle specific disputes between Shireroth and Antica.
--1.The Board of Grievances shall consist of three representatives from both the Imperial Republic of Shireroth and the Republic of Antica.
--2.The methods by which representatives are appointed are to be determined by each country seperately.
--3.The Board of Grievances shall handle disputes between Antica and Shireroth on a case by case basis until a solution can be found.
B.) The Imperial Republic of Shireroth pledges to work towards establishing trade with the Republic of Antica in the event that an economy is formed within Shireroth.
C.) Both nations pledge to encourage dual citizenship with each other in order to promote peace and cooperation between the two.

ARTICLE 3: Everything Else

A.) THE IMPERIAL REPUBLIC OF SHIREROTH and the REPUBLIC OF ANTICA recognize the sovereignty and territory of eachother, and pledge not to attack eachother in an unscheduled or malicious manner.
B.) THE IMPERIAL REPUBLIC OF SHIREROTH and the REPUBLIC OF ANTICA agree to delegate all disputes to the Board of Grievances.
C.) As a measure of good will, THE IMPERIAL REPUBLIC OF SHIREROTH and the REPUBLIC OF ANTICA both agree to allow either nation to rescind this treaty by whatever means standard in either micronations.
